Huddle Global 2024: Meet Raul, the 14-year-old prodigy who teaches his own teachers
Trivandrum / November 28, 2024
Thiruvananthapuram, Nov. 28: Imagine taking classes for your teachers at your own school. Raul John Aju, a 14-year-old from Edappally Government Vocational Higher Secondary School had this rare opportunity at the venue of Huddle Global 2024, India’s flagship startup festival organized by Kerala Startup Mission (KSUM) at Kovalam here.
The teenager could pull off this feat owing to his deep expertise in AI and Robotics, acquired by dint of his total dedication since childhood.
Raul’s amazing proficiency in AI and Robotics was in full display at the very first session of the three-day event.
During his session titled ‘Dream Big Code Bigger-Shaping the future with technology,’ Raul explained to the audience the various AI tools that could help anyone with an idea to start a startup single handedly.
“Various AI applications can be used to strategically build a startup from scratch. From business model to business feasibility of your product, AI can be used to create website, create logos, for business presentations and marketing,” Raul pointed out, creating an enthusiastic resonance from the listeners.
“AI can be used to create all the verticals needed for a startup,” said Raul.
“KSUM and it’s CEO Anoop Ambika has helped me throughout the process of making Nyaya Sathi,” Raul said.
Raul also takes classes to international students and employees working in US and UK companies. He teaches about the working of AI, machine learning, deep learning neural and AI language models.
“I use AI to create presentations for my classes and sessions which helps me save a lot of time amidst my studies and daily activities,” said Raul, who believes it’s not AI that is going take the jobs but people who knows how to use AI.
“AI is the present and future. It increases productivity and revenue and will open a new world full of possibilities,” said Raul reeling out stats that showed how AI has increased the productivity of many corporate giants.
Appreciating his presentation, IT-Electronics Secretary Dr Rathan U Kelkar presented a memento to Raul on behalf of KSUM.
